Concert

concert
I. noun Etymology: French, from Italian ~o, from ~are Date: 1571 agreement in design or plan ; union formed by mutual communication of opinion and views, musical harmony ; concord, a public performance (as of music or dancing), ~ adjective II. verb see: certain Date: 1652 transitive verb to make a plan for , to settle or adjust by conferring and reaching an agreement , intransitive verb to act in harmony or conjunction

  n. & v. --n. 1 a musical performance of usu. several separate compositions. 2 agreement, accordance, harmony. 3 a combination of voices or sounds. --v.tr. arrange (by mutual agreement or coordination). Phrases and idioms concert-goer a person who often goes to concerts. concert grand the largest size of grand piano, used for concerts. concert-master esp. US the leading first-violin player in some orchestras. concert overture Mus. a piece like an overture but intended for independent performance. concert performance Mus. a performance (of an opera etc.) without scenery, costumes, or action. concert pitch 1 Mus. the pitch internationally agreed in 1960 whereby the A above middle C = 440 Hz. 2 a state of unusual readiness, efficiency, and keenness (for action etc.). in concert 1 (often foll. by with) acting jointly and accordantly. 2 (predic.) (of a musician) in a performance. Etymology: F concert (n.), concerter (v.) f. It. concertare harmonize ...
